Avoidantly attached people aren’t emotionless. They’re survivors of emotional chaos. If you learned to shut down, stay distant, or become hyper-independent… It wasn’t because you didn’t crave closeness. It’s because closeness felt unsafe. Your psyche said: “If I stay distant, maybe I’ll stay safe.” That wasn’t weakness. It was strategy. Insecure attachment—whether anxious or avoidant—isn’t a flaw. It’s your nervous system protecting you the best way it knew how. You weren’t broken. You were adaptive. And that same brilliance can now guide you toward secure, nourishing love.

Relationships are culturally bound. Love, a force that should flow freely, is often confined by societal boundaries. These constraints, rooted in factors like race, religion, and sexuality, limit our understanding and experience of love. However, by courageously challenging these cultural expectations, we can liberate ourselves and open our minds to new, unrestricted possibilities more aligned with who we are. This empowerment is the key to taking control of our love lives.
We often further narrow down our expectations by creating a detailed list of the qualities we believe define the perfect relationship. We may think we can attract our ideal partner by writing these qualities down, when we don't even understand who we are. By doing that, we overlook the importance of focusing on self-improvement. By becoming the best version of ourselves, we increase our chances of attracting the right partner. This emphasis on self-improvement should not just motivate us, but inspire us to strive to become complete individuals on our own rather than fixating on the fantasy of an ideal person.
Many people share steps for finding love, but no formula works more authentically than the practice of loving ourselves, no matter how cliché it may seem. The ego keeps us safe. Serving as a survival instinct, it has played a crucial role in our evolutionary journey, distinguishing us from other species. However, this instinct, which was once essential, has now extended too far. It has led to harmful separations, such as discrimination based on race, religion, or sexuality, and even to the annihilation of other species. This harmful extension of the ego has led us to view those we deem different from ourselves as 'the other,' fostering a sense of conflict. Yet, what we need to see is we are fighting against ourselves.
We must learn to rise above the ego, as it can pit us against every other living being. Everything exists for a reason, even if we don't fully understand its purpose. For example, who would have thought that the extinction of bees could lead to our own demise?
The desire to stand out should not interfere with our need to connect with others. In fact, both are essential, and that's completely normal. The problem arises when we focus solely on our differences and fail to recognize that the energy within all living beings is the same energy that exists within us. When we yearn for more, we are often seeking a deeper connection to the universal aspect of ourselves that links us to every living thing.

Nervous system regulation expert Sheridan Ruth reveals the hidden beliefs creating anxiety in your relationships, finances, and self-worth in this powerful clip from Sex Reimagined Podcast Episode #139. The root of most relationship struggles isn't incompatibility—it's seeking safety from outside sources instead of cultivating it within. When we unconsciously believe our safety depends on our partner's behavior, our bank account, or others' approval, we create a stress response that keeps us perpetually anxious. Sheridan shares how to identify these unconscious beliefs by noticing your body's signals and creating "embodied safety" instead. This revolutionary approach doesn't require changing your circumstances—it transforms how your nervous system interprets those circumstances.
